Time limit of 6 months applicable to Dealers to pass on the credit

Guest

Dear Sir,

As per notification no 21/2014 whether the time limit of 6 months is applicable for traded goods, to pass on the cenvat credit. Because Since the time limit is mentioned for only Inputs and inputs services as per notification,Please clarify and please give any references regarding this,

Thanks and regards.

Six month limit on CENVAT credit applies to those taking credit, not to dealers merely passing it on. The notification bars manufacturers and providers of output services from taking CENVAT credit after six months from the date of specified documents; this time limit targets those who avail credit and does not apply to dealers who merely pass on credit without availing it. Consequently, where a dealer issues an invoice to pass on credit for traded goods, the recipient must take the credit within six months of the invoice date. (AI Summary)

Madhukar N Hiregange on Sep 23, 2014

The dealers do not avail the credit and ONLY pass on the credit, therefore the restriction doe s not apply to them. The invoice issued by them - credit by receiver to be taken within 6 months of the date.

Mahir S on Sep 23, 2014

The words used in the said notification are :-

“Provided also that the manufacturer or the provider of output service shall not take CENVAT credit after six months of the date of issue of any of the documents specified in sub- rule (1) of rule 9.”;

Hence, the condition is applicable only to manufacturer and to the provider of output service and in no way related to Dealer.
